Del Taco Testing New Sweet Potato Crunch Bites?

We’ve long come to terms with the big Mexican fast food chains serving up some questionably non-Mexican flavors. It’s going to take a few minutes for us to adjust our palettes and mindset to accept this latest test item from Del Taco, the new Sweet Potato Crunch Bites

This particular item was spotted in rotation at an Anaheim, CA Del Taco location (corner of Lincoln and Rio Vista) with a description that read: “Snackable Bites of Crispy Sweet Potatoes.”

A snack size (undisclosed number of pieces) will set you back $1.99, and the Regular Size (shown in the picture) will cost you $2.79. More on this item as it comes to us. No word about any system-wide rollout.
